I hate to be the killjoy, but the engine from your Combat Wombat looks suspiciously like an iron barreled Wombat engine. The Wombat engine has one major difference that prevents it from being a drop in replacement, this being that the Combat Wombat pipe will not mate to the Wombat cylinder. The alt...

I think Brian is right, It appears that the bottom two pictures are a 94 Wombat engine, not a 95 Combat Wombat. The lower ends are about the same except for straight cut primary gears in the 95. The 95 has a different piston, cylinder, head and a 28mm carb vs a 24mm for the 94. This is all unfortun...
